Common Chamberlain Garage Door Problems We Solve in Lancaster
- Torsion springs snapping prematurely. Lancaster’s 105°F summer highs and fine Mojave dust accelerate metal fatigue. Standard OEM springs rated for 10,000 cycles often fail in 7,000 here. We install heavy-duty aftermarket torsion springs with the same cycle rating but better corrosion resistance.
- Safety sensor lens fogging. Wide diurnal swings — 105°F afternoons dropping to 40°F nights — cause condensation inside Chamberlain sensor housings. The opener reads this as an obstruction and refuses to close. We see this most in west Lancaster’s 93536 tract homes where garages face the afternoon sun.
- Bottom seals cracking within two years. Intense UV and dry desert air destroy rubber faster than coastal markets. Once the seal gaps, windborne grit enters the track and accelerates roller wear. We stock UV-resistant EPDM seals that hold up better here.
- MyQ Wi-Fi modules losing connection. Lancaster’s frequent high-wind events cause power flickers, not router failures. The Chamberlain B970’s Wi-Fi board reboots and drops pairing. We check power stability and recommend surge protection as standard practice.
- Panels racked or blown off tracks after wind events. Standard builder-grade steel doors in 1990s–2000s west Lancaster developments lack wind-load struts. A 50 mph gust can push a 16×7 door’s bottom section completely out of its vertical track. We install horizontal strut bracing and verify permit-compliant wind pressure ratings.
Chamberlain Service in Lancaster: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Lancaster sits directly under the Antelope Valley wind corridor, where sustained 50–70 mph gusts don’t just rattle doors — they can physically push standard sectional panels out of their bottom tracks without wind-load struts, a failure mode that’s extremely rare even in nearby Chamberlain repair in Palmdale. Local permit inspections specifically scrutinize wind pressure ratings and horizontal/vertical strut bracing in a way most LA Basin cities do not. For Chamberlain owners, this means your opener’s force settings and limit switches need recalibration after any significant wind event, even if the door looks fine. The WD832KEV chain drive and RJO20 wall-mount both have sensitive limit switches that drift when the door encounters repeated wind pressure. Near Avenue K and 30th Street West, a homeowner called us after a spring wind event racked their Chamberlain WD832KEV’s 16×7 steel door out of its bottom track. We replaced the bent bottom panel, installed a wind-load strut kit, recalibrated the limit switches, and added heavy-gauge galvanized springs — the whole job took one afternoon. Doors that meet code in Santa Clarita or Burbank can bow, rack, or blow out entirely in Lancaster’s wind events. We factor this into every Chamberlain service call in the 93534 and 93535 corridors.

Minor bowing in a single panel can sometimes be straightened if the steel hasn’t creased. Multiple panels or any crease means replacement — the structural integrity is compromised and will fail again. Wind pressure flexes the door sections, causing the opener to encounter unexpected resistance. The force-sensing logic interprets this as an obstruction and backs off, effectively teaching itself a new (wrong) limit position.
